服务器网络优化的核心在于构建高可用、低延迟的网络架构体系,而非单一参数的调优,真正的性能提升源于物理链路质量、内核协议栈配置与应用层策略的深度协同,通过系统化的调优手段,可将网络吞吐量提升30%以上,同时显著降低业务响应延迟。

物理链路与架构层面的根本性优化
网络优化的基石在于物理传输层,任何忽视物理架构的软件调优都是徒劳。
-
线路质量甄选与BGP智能调度
服务器网络性能的上限由运营商线路决定,在实战中,优质的双线或三线BGP线路远优于廉价的单线带宽,对于跨地域业务,必须引入智能路由策略,根据用户ISP自动切换最优路径,简米科技在为某大型电商客户部署服务器时,通过接入高质量的多线BGP资源,成功将跨网访问延迟从80ms降低至20ms以内,彻底解决了南北互通问题。 -
网卡硬件参数调优
现代服务器网卡具备丰富的硬件卸载功能。开启GSO(Generic Segmentation Offload)、GRO(Generic Receive Offload)及TSO(TCP Segmentation Offload),将数据包分片与重组工作卸载至网卡硬件处理,可大幅降低CPU软中断负载,使用ethtool工具将网卡多队列RSS(Receive Side Scaling)配置为CPU核心数匹配模式,确保网络中断负载均匀分布,避免单核瓶颈。
Linux内核协议栈的深度调优
操作系统默认的网络参数往往为了兼容性而牺牲了性能,针对高并发场景必须进行定制化修改。
-
TCP连接建立与回收机制
高并发环境下,TCP连接的快速建立与释放至关重要。必须开启TCP_TW_REUSE选项,允许将TIME-WAIT状态的socket重新用于新的TCP连接,防止大量TIME-WAIT占用端口资源,调整tcp_max_syn_backlog与somaxconn参数,扩大半连接与全连接队列长度,有效抵御突发流量冲击,避免连接被丢弃。
-
TCP传输窗口与缓冲区动态调整
传统TCP窗口大小限制了长肥网络(LFN)的吞吐量。启用TCP窗口缩放选项,并将tcp_rmem与tcp_wmem的缓冲区范围扩大,允许TCP根据网络状况动态调整接收与发送窗口,在长距离数据传输场景中,这一调整能显著提升带宽利用率,实测可将文件传输速度提升2-3倍。 -
拥塞控制算法的迭代
默认的CUBIC算法在数据中心内部或高丢包网络中表现平平。建议升级至BBR(Bottleneck Bandwidth and Round-trip propagation time)拥塞控制算法,BBR不再依赖丢包信号判断拥塞,而是通过测量链路带宽与RTT来控制发送速率,在高丢包率网络环境下,BBR能保持极高的吞吐量,这是服务器网络优化实战经验中性价比最高的技术手段之一。
应用层协议与负载均衡策略
内核层优化解决了传输效率问题,应用层优化则直接决定用户体验。
-
HTTP/2与HTTP/3协议部署
HTTP/1.1的队头阻塞问题严重制约页面加载速度。全面启用HTTP/2协议,利用多路复用特性在单一TCP连接上并发传输资源,可减少TCP握手开销,更进一步,部署基于QUIC协议的HTTP/3,彻底解决TCP层面的队头阻塞,在弱网环境下优势尤为明显,首屏加载时间可缩短40%。 -
智能负载均衡与长连接复用
在后端服务架构中,四层负载均衡(L4)应结合七层负载均衡(L7)使用,四层负责高性能转发,七层负责路由分发与会话保持,务必在反向代理与后端服务器之间启用Keep-Alive长连接,避免频繁的TCP握手消耗服务器算力,简米科技提供的负载均衡解决方案,通过优化连接池配置,成功帮助某游戏客户支撑了百万级并发在线,服务器资源利用率反而下降了20%。
全链路监控与故障排查体系

没有监控的优化是盲目的,建立可观测性体系是网络运维的关键。
-
精细化流量分析
部署eBPF(扩展伯克利包过滤器)技术,在内核层面实现无侵入式的网络观测。实时监控TCP重传率、RTT延迟及丢包率,精准定位网络抖动根源,一旦发现重传率超过1%,即触发告警,这通常是物理链路故障或带宽拥堵的早期信号。 -
链路追踪与根因分析
在分布式架构中,网络延迟往往隐藏在复杂的调用链中。引入全链路追踪系统,将网络耗时从业务逻辑中剥离出来分析,通过可视化图谱,快速识别出慢查询节点,判断是网络IO瓶颈还是服务处理瓶颈。
服务器网络优化是一个持续迭代的过程,需要结合业务特性不断调整,通过上述物理架构升级、内核参数调优、应用协议革新及监控体系建设,可构建出极致性能的网络环境,简米科技持续深耕基础设施服务领域,提供从底层硬件到上层应用的全方位网络优化支持,助力企业业务在数字时代极速奔跑。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/66514.html